WebDec 15, 2024 · Iran’s goal was to export 2.3 million barrels per day of crude oil and condensate at an average price of $40 per barrel, for the Iranian year that started in March 2024. The price estimate was quite conservative—the Brent oil price, a global benchmark, has averaged $73 per barrel since March—but the volume target was off by a wide margin.
